> It was suggested that we have audio loopback turned on in our linux kernel.
I've never seen such an option when building a kernel.  More likely is
that loopback is turned on in an audio control panel somewhere.
Look for "xmixer" or "amixer" or some such little commandline/GUI program
which adjusts your soundcard's settings.  There'll probably be a button
to push under the microphone-volume slider which toggles loopback (it
may be called mute/unmute).  Experiment...
